Memphis Redbirds (AAA): Won 4-0 over Oklahoma City

Adron Chambers got thing going for the Redbirds tonight, with two hits and two runs scored. Peterson knocked in a RBI, Romak added two RBI, and Garcia added two hits. Richard Castillo started and shut out the RedHawks for five innings, and the bullpen was stellar, with Tyler Lyons, Jose Alarmante, and Keith Butler keeping the clean sheet.

Springfield Cardinals (AA): Lost 4-1 to Arkansas

Adam Melker plated the lone RBI for Springfield. The Cardinals also committed three erros, leading to Zach Russell and Danny Miranda’s combined three unearned runs allowed. Russell took the loss.

Palm Beach Cardinals (A): Won 4-1 over Charlotte

Jacob Wilson and Jesus Montero had two hits each, with Wilson scoring two runs and Montero driving in two RBI. Jonathan Rodriguez got on base four times (2 BB, 2 H) in five ABs. Sam Gaviglio went eight innings, only allowing five hits and one run to earn the win. Ronnie Shaban secured the save.

Peoria Chiefs (A): Lost 4-2 to Clinton 

Only six hits for Peoria tonight, with Jordan Walton hitting an RBI double and Trevor Martin going 2-4 with a RBI. Kyle Helisek pitched seven innings, giving up three runs to take the loss.

State College Spikes (A): Won 6-4 over Jamestown

Michael Schulze went 3-4 with a RBI and Steven Ramos added two hits, a double, and a run scored. Jimmy Reed started and gave up four runs in four innings, so it was Victor De Leon who started the bullpen’s clean sheet to earn the win.

Johnson City Cardinals (Rookie): Won 10-3 over Burlington

Jhohan Acevedo lef the Cardinals with three hits, three RBI, one home run, and two runs scored. Ronnierd Garcia added two hits and three RBI as well. Dailyn Martinez pitched five innings and earned the win, while the bullpen only gave up one hit in four innings of relief.
